Affton High School Alumni

St. Louis, Missouri (MO)

AlumniClass Home  >  Missouri  >  Affton High School  >  Class of 1962  >  Peggy O'leary

Peggy Babcock (Peggy O'leary)

Affton High School
Class of 1962

→ Join 1935 Alumni from Affton High School that have already claimed their alumni profiles.
→ There are 70 classes, starting with the class of 1944 all the way up to class of 2023.

PEGGY'S PROFILE

This is a limited view of Peggy's profile, register for free or login to view all their profile information.
No photo uploaded
First Name Peggy
Last Name Babcock
Maiden Name O'leary
Graduation Year Class of 1962
Gender Female
City N/A
State/Province MO
Country United States
Occupation retired
Married Widowed
No photo uploaded

Class of 1962 Alumni and Other Nearby Classes

→ Reunite with 13 class of 1962 classmates that have joined.

Judy Dietmeyer

Judy Dietmeyer
Class of 1963

Ben Sutterfield

Ben Sutterfield
Class of 2003

Michael Hayden

Michael Hayden
Class of 1973

Mark Ries

Mark Ries
Class of 1975

Cynthia Cline

Cynthia Cline
Class of 1965

Kevin Cook

Kevin Cook
Class of 1991

Richard Robb

Richard Robb
Class of 1956

Terry Thompson

Terry Thompson
Class of 1960

Scott Mullin

Scott Mullin
Class of 1981

Karen Murawski

Karen Murawski
Class of 1962

Mike Havener

Mike Havener
Class of 1990

Paul Black

Paul Black
Class of 2009

Mark Mcnary

Mark Mcnary
Class of 1981

Michelle Gray

Michelle Gray
Class of 1971

Shamae Jarrett

Shamae Jarrett
Class of 1999

Scott Rivera

Scott Rivera
Class of 1991

Anne Imlay

Anne Imlay
Class of 1974

Judy Craven

Judy Craven
Class of 1963

Sara Beck

Sara Beck
Class of 2003

Karenann Yarbrough

Karenann Yarbrough
Class of 1976

Louis Meyer

Louis Meyer
Class of 1994

Janine Ruess

Janine Ruess
Class of 1981

Babak Falasiri

Babak Falasiri
Class of 1994

Recent Class of 1962 Reunions

Plan a Class of 1962 Reunion for Free

Class of 1969 - 50th Class Reunion

Invited Classes: All Classes

Date: Sep 14, 2019

Description: Advance reservations and payment are needed to be made by June 1, 2019! Why wait? Mail your payment today! Cost...(read more)

More Details →